The Office

Established in 1984 and located in the heart of the City our Exeter office has evolved into a full-service law firm and the first point of call for many corporate and individual clients in the South West and beyond.

Our expertise takes in both public and private sectors, with a particular focus on Real Estate – both residential and commercial property. We have teams who advise on construction, employment, litigation and dispute resolution, property finance, and corporate advice.

We are also well known for our work in wealth management, residential property conveyancing, and agriculture. We are an acknowledged expert in specialist travel insurance law.

Our Exeter office is home to a team of 146 staff, led by 22 partners. Our locally based lawyers have a deep understanding of what matters to clients in the South West. In turn, our clients choose us for our high levels of service and expertise, and also for the value for money we can offer by utilising our regional teams.

We have an enviable reputation for bringing public and private and charity sectors together in innovative joint ventures. Our in-depth understanding of the public sector and the rules and regulations it operates within, as well as the commercial drivers for our private sector clients, means we can find practical and workable solutions, and do so efficiently and economically.

The Opportunity

We are looking to recruit an Associate/Senior Associate into our Commercial team based in the Exeter office.

The department offers our clients access to a full range of corporate and commercial legal services, advising on a range of commercial matters for business clients, from start-ups, SMEs and larger corporates to family businesses and a range of public sector clients (including standard terms and conditions, partnership agreements, joint ventures, development agreements, bespoke service contracts and IT/data issues). The team also further supports public sector clients on commercial issues including outsourcing, public sector companies and commercialisation.

Working as part of a high-performing national and growing regional team, the new recruit will advise clients operating in a variety of sectors on a diverse range of commercial matters.

The Corporate/Commercial department is supported by specialists in our other departments, including banking, tax, employment and intellectual property.

The role will include a range of key activities to include providing a first-class service to clients, proactive marketing/profile raising, exceptional client and team/office management.  Specifically:

  • Advising on a range of commercial agreements;
  • Drafting a range of commercial documents and advise on key areas of risk dependent on sector area of client;
  • Advising on partnership and joint venture agreements;
  • Advising on outsourcing arrangements;
  • Advising on ad hoc day-to-day commercial queries from our varied client base;
  • Supporting General Counsel on business critical projects in designated timeframes;
  • An understanding of GDPR, EU procurement and public law helpful but not essential;
  • Initiating, building and maintaining effective client relationships;
  • Ensuring files are managed in compliance with Lexcel procedures;
  • Promotions, and co-managing quarterly check-ins; attending periodic meetings of the International Corporate and Partner Groups to discuss strategy, marketing and coordinating inter-office team support.
  • Pro-active participation in department and firm-wide marketing initiatives.
